Evidence supporting the use of: Chamomile
For the health condition: Acid Indigestion
Synopsis
Source of validity: Traditional
Rating (out of 5): 2
Chamomile (Matricaria recutita and Chamaemelum nobile) has long been used in traditional medicine systems, particularly in Europe, for the relief of gastrointestinal complaints, including acid indigestion (also known as dyspepsia). Historical texts and folk practices describe chamomile tea and extracts as soothing agents for the digestive tract, helping to reduce symptoms such as bloating, nausea, and mild stomach discomfort after eating. The presumed mechanisms include chamomile’s mild antispasmodic and anti-inflammatory effects, which may relax the smooth muscles of the gut and ease discomfort.
While there is a substantial tradition of chamomile use for digestive issues, scientific evidence supporting its efficacy for acid indigestion specifically remains limited. Some animal studies and small clinical trials suggest that chamomile extracts might reduce gastric acidity and protect the stomach lining, but these findings are not robust or definitive. Most clinical research examines chamomile in combination with other herbs, making it difficult to isolate its effects. As a result, the primary justification for chamomile’s use in acid indigestion is based on traditional and anecdotal evidence rather than solid scientific validation. Chamomile is generally considered safe for most people when consumed as a tea or in moderate amounts, but its effectiveness for acid indigestion has not been conclusively demonstrated in large, well-controlled human studies.
